My work with Pratham Books - Bangalore, India
My journey with Pratham Books began in 2009. My first work was to design an annual report in B/W and single colour. 
This gave us the idea to try and produce coloured books that were also more cost effective So the first set of 4 books -
Can and Can't, Do and Don't, This and That and Curly and straight were a result of that experiment. 

Then I worked on Paper Play - the title is a dead giveaway, because what I did was I really played and explored paper to 
craft each illustration and character. When Amma went to School was set in a village school, so I opted for bright primary colours and cutouts to craft the visuals. It also had a snake - and I did not wan't children to be afraid of the creature hence 
I crafted a paper cut snake painted with bright blue and yellow lines. By this time I had published nine books with them. 
Each book was like a challenge that has taken me down a different path. 


All these books are available on Creative Commons, and are downloadable and readable in different countries. 
Artists, teachers and parents can download them from Story Weaver, translate them and print them to create more 
reading materials for themselves and the children. Bahasa (Indonesia), German, Chinese, Tibetan, Amharic, Norwegian 
and Korean are just some of the languages in which these stories have been translated into on Story Weaver.  


Do and don't
Do and don't - is about a little boy who refuses to do anything!
This book was a part of a series that was designed cost effectively. It is printed in two colours, 
reducing the cost of production, and thereby making the book more affordable.

Paper Play
Paper Play- is about what children can do with a single piece of paper. They can make things from it and dive into their imaginary world. 
The illustrations were made from paper and paper shreds keeping this in mind.
